Thorsten Raff
About
Thorsten Raff has authored 32 papers that have received a total of 2.5k indexed citations.
This includes 18 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ine, 13 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 11 papers in Hematology. The topics of these papers are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(18 papers), Acute Lymphoblastic Leukemia research (13 papers) and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ia Research (10 papers). Thorsten Raff is often cited by papers focused on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(18 papers), Acute Lymphoblastic Leukemia research (13 papers) and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ia Research (10 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Germany, The Netherlands and United Kingdom. Thorsten Raff's co-authors include Monika Brüggemann, Michael Kneba, Matthias Ritgen, Dieter Hoelzer and Christiane Pott and has published in prestigious journals such as Blood, The Journal of Pathology and Journal of Immunological Methods.
